Treatment Management and Factors Affecting Mortality in Retroperitoneal Hemorrhage Due to Cardiac Catheterization; Single Center Experience
Bleeding complications after cardiac catheterization have been reviewed previously, but there are very few studies on retroperitoneal hematoma and appropriate treatment of patients is not well defined. For this reason, the investigators aimed to analyze the clinical manifestations of retroperitoneal hematomas in a single center using a case-control study design, to analyze the treatment procedure determinants and consequently to provide an updated and usable treatment algorithm.

Inclusion criteria
- Retroperitoneal hematoma following cardiac catheterization
Exclusion criteria
- Patients with retroperitoneal hematomas other than cardiac catheterization and patients with missing file records.
